2015 Kuga Audio system fault. (ACM repair?)

Featured Replies

Good evening all

I have been asked to look at a 2015 Ford Kuga, he has mentioned the following intermittent faults: 

- no sound through any speakers on any input 

- radio stuck on DAB. FM does not work

- parking sensors intermittently not working

- CD player accepts a disc, but no sound at all

- Phone connectivity seems to work, but again, no sound. 

- before the speakers stopped working, he noticed a popping sound

The prime suspect so far seems to be the audio control module which I believe is the amplifier unit. 

The car has the Sony head unit with the small LCD screen near the windscreen. Sorry I'm not sure which version of Sync this is? 

Have scanned the car and there are no fault codes in the ACM. He said the faults have been intermittent and have gradually got worse. The battery failed a couple of months ago, the issues started just before then, and got worse just after the battery was replaced. Probably coincidental

A company called Revtronics seem to offer a repair service. 

The other option seems to be getting a new unit from Ford which will require programming. This would be an expensive guess. 

Has anyone encountered similar faults before?
